How Common Is The Last Name Hitomi? popularity and diffusion
Hitomi is the 31,751st most widespread family name on a global scale, borne by around 1 in 433,782 people. It occurs predominantly in Asia, where 98 percent of Hitomi reside; 98 percent reside in East Asia and 98 percent reside in Nippono-Asia. Hitomi is also the 18,929th most frequent first name in the world. It is borne by 48,758 people.
This last name is most prevalent in Japan, where it is borne by 16,425 people, or 1 in 7,784. In Japan Hitomi is most frequent in: Tochigi Prefecture, where 21 percent reside, Kyoto Prefecture, where 16 percent reside and Ibaraki Prefecture, where 10 percent reside. Outside of Japan it occurs in 27 countries. It is also common in The United States, where 1 percent reside and Brazil, where 1 percent reside.
